# Encoding detection for uploaded text files (Fernwick ingest).
# Support: if a customer reports garbled imports, the sniffer probably
# guessed wrong. We sample the file head, score candidate encodings,
# and fall back to UTF-8 when confidence is low. Do not edit these
# values without checking with the Pellbrook team first; they are
# load-bearing for legacy Latin-1 customers. The current constants
# are listed below.

constants for tageg-kagag:
QUOTAS = {
    "kelax": 495,
    "istath": 366,
    "tammir": 108,
    "novdor": 730,
    "casax": 816,
    "quenael": 874,
    "pelius": 403,
}

Ticket #4471 — Plugin vault locked during profile-store resharding. While Quillbase migrates user profiles to the new shard layout, the plugin credential vault auto-locked. External plugin authors cannot publish until it is reopened. To unlock your staging copy, run vault-open from the plugin SDK and supply the shared recovery passphrase shown below.

vault phrase of bagaf-kajeg = jorath-feniel-briir-siliel-ralix

// Welcome aboard — quick context before you touch this. This constant is the
// rollout percentage for the Mistral Hollow consent banner. We ramp it region
// by region because the Ardenfall legal team wants sign-off at each step, and
// once a user sees the banner we can't un-show it. So: bump this only after
// the gating flag flips in the config service, never the other way around.
// Yes, it's annoying; no, don't hardcode 100. The build this ramp value last
// shipped in is noted below.

session token of bajog-tadup = htk3_ffc